Safety, Honestly: Confidence, Not Fear

This is the section every women's-travel page should give straight, and most either fear-monger or gloss over. The honest position: the Golden Triangle is among India's safer, most tourist-experienced routes, and safety means reducing risk through good choices rather than achieving zero risk. Specifics that actually help: A driver and guide remove most friction. You are met on arrival and moved door to door, so you are not navigating stations or fielding touts alone — the single biggest comfort lever. A female guide adds safety and ease. Beyond feeling more comfortable, it makes asking women's questions about dress, customs and comfort natural; we arrange one on request, in any or all three cities. Stay central and vetted: Delhi's South Delhi and Connaught Place, Agra's Tajganj near the Taj, Jaipur's C-Scheme and Bani Park. We book central, 24-hour-reception hotels, not cheap-but-isolated ones. Dress modestly to blend in: shoulders and knees covered, kurtas, loose trousers, a scarf. It reduces unwanted attention and respects local norms. Evenings and transport: limit solo outings late at night, keep to busy central areas, and use app cabs (Uber, Ola) or hotel-arranged transport after dark. The Delhi Metro has women-only coaches for daytime hops. Trust your instincts: if a place feels off, head to a cafe or your hotel; tell your hotel where you are going. The Female-Guide Difference

A female guide is more than a safety choice; it changes what you see and how it feels: The women's stories at the monuments, which standard tours skip: Mumtaz Mahal and Nur Jahan at the Taj and Agra Fort, the Hawa Mahal built so royal women could watch city life unseen, Delhi's female Sufi saints. Ease and connection: questions about dress, customs and comfort feel natural, and many women find the markets fun rather than overwhelming with a woman guiding. Women-led experiences on request: henna, a saree-draping session, a cooking class with a local woman, visits to women artisans, block-printing and textile studios run by women.

Is the Golden Triangle safe for women travellers?

It is among India's safer, most tourist-experienced routes, travelled happily by many women every year. Safety comes from good choices: a driver and guide, central well-reviewed hotels, modest dress, app cabs at night, limiting late solo outings, and an optional female guide. It means reducing risk, not zero risk, and we give honest specifics rather than fear.
